From our perspective, the vibrant reds, purples, pinks, and oranges you admire are not merely for show; they are our sophisticated survival toolkit. We, Echeverias, naturally produce green chlorophyll for photosynthesis. However, we also manufacture other pigments, like anthocyanins (reds and purples) and carotenoids (oranges and yellows). These pigments are always present but are often masked by the dominant green chlorophyll. The process you call "stressing" is, for us, a controlled environmental response where we increase the production of these colorful pigments to protect ourselves from various external factors. It is our version of putting on sunscreen and a protective jacket.
The single most important factor for us to show our true colors is intense light. When we receive abundant, direct sunlight, our internal systems recognize the potential for photodamage. To protect our delicate photosynthetic tissues from the sun's powerful rays, we ramp up production of anthocyanins. These pigments act as a natural sunscreen, absorbing harmful UV light and dissipating the energy as heat, thereby shielding the chlorophyll underneath. The more intense and prolonged the light exposure, the more "sunscreen" we produce, and the more vibrant our colors become. Without enough light, we will prioritize chlorophyll production to capture every available photon, resulting in a green, stretched-out appearance as we reach for the sun.
While light initiates the color change, temperature acts as a powerful intensifier. We are most efficient at producing sugars through photosynthesis in warm conditions. However, cooler temperatures, especially cool nights, slow down our metabolic processes. This chill causes us to slow down our consumption of the sugars we produce during the day. The buildup of these sugars in our leaves further stimulates the production of protective anthocyanins. The contrast between warm days and cool nights (a differential of 15-20°F or more) is the most effective trigger, creating a beautiful stress response without pushing us into dangerous dormancy or frost damage.
Your watering habits play a crucial role in our color transformation. To encourage stress colors, you must allow us to experience a mild, controlled thirst. When you water us sparingly and only when the soil is completely dry, we enter a state of mild water stress. In anticipation of drier conditions, we may tighten our rosette shape and begin to reabsorb water and nutrients from our older, lower leaves. This process not only conserves resources but also breaks down the green chlorophyll in those leaves, allowing the underlying yellow and orange carotenoid pigments to become visible. It is a careful balance; too much water forces rapid growth and dilutes our colors, while too little can damage our roots and halt all pigment production.
Our ability to manage water and nutrients is directly tied to the home you provide. We require a gritty, extremely well-draining soil mix. This ensures that water does not linger around our roots, preventing rot and allowing for the dry periods that encourage color development. A pot that is only slightly larger than our root system is ideal. An oversized pot holds excess soil, which retains water for too long, promoting root growth and green vegetative growth at the expense of the beautiful stress colors you desire. A snug pot helps you control water intake more effectively, supporting the overall stressing process.
